1. Preparing Concrete Block Machines for Overseas Shipment

Before a machine leaves the factory, its main components need to be assembled and checked according to the production line configuration. Large mechanical structures, hydraulic components, electrical systems, molds, pallet handling equipment, and other auxiliary equipment may all need to be prepared for shipment.

For international projects, equipment is normally divided into suitable shipping units according to its size and transportation requirements. This makes loading and unloading more manageable while also helping protect the equipment during transportation.

4. Why Factory Assembly Matters for Machine Quality

A concrete block machine contains many moving components. The forming system, feeding mechanism, hydraulic system, vibration system, pallet handling equipment, and control system all need to work together during production.

Proper factory assembly helps technicians identify potential problems before the machine is shipped. It also makes it possible to check mechanical movement, component installation, electrical connections, and the interaction between different systems.

For overseas projects, this preparation is particularly important because the equipment will later be installed far away from the manufacturer's factory. Detecting and correcting problems before shipment can help reduce unnecessary installation and commissioning difficulties at the customer's site.

5. Large-Scale Equipment Requires Professional Handling

Large industrial machines cannot be treated like ordinary cargo. Their weight, dimensions, center of gravity, lifting points, and packaging condition all need to be considered during loading.

The factory photographs show the use of lifting equipment and forklifts when moving machinery and components. These handling methods help position heavy equipment safely inside the workshop and during loading operations.

7. What Should Buyers Look for in a Block Machine Manufacturer?

When comparing suppliers, buyers often focus on machine specifications and price. These are important, but they are not the only factors that determine the long-term value of industrial equipment.

A buyer should also consider:

  • Manufacturing capability: Does the supplier have its own production and assembly facilities?
  • Mechanical quality: Are the main structures and moving components manufactured and assembled properly?
  • Equipment integration: Can the supplier provide the main machine together with suitable molds and auxiliary equipment?
  • Pre-shipment inspection: Is the equipment checked before it leaves the factory?
  • Packaging and loading: Does the supplier have experience preparing heavy machinery for international transportation?
  • After-sales support: Can the supplier provide technical assistance during installation and commissioning?
